The 2015 Proof New Mexico Navajo Cougar 1 oz Silver Coin pays tribute to the Navajo tribe. Each of the coins in this collection, released by the Native American Mint, honors the tribal nations recognized in North America. Each of the designs features a tribal nation and an animal that is native to the area the tribe was known to live in. This coin pays homage to the cougar, a North American wild cat known for being sleek and stealthy. Each of the coins contains 1 Troy oz of .999 pure silver and is considered to be highly collectible amongst both the investor and the collector of Native American artwork.

There are over 300,000 registered members of the Navajo Nation, which makes it the second largest of all federally recognized tribes across the United States. The Navajo Nation is actually an independent government that is tasked with the management of the Navajo reservation that is found at Four Corners, which is where New Mexico, Arizona, Utah, and Nevada intersect.

While this coin pays tribute to the New Mexico Navajo people, the state is actually home to only the second largest population of Navajo tribe members. Arizona has more than 20,000 members over the population of New Mexico.

Obverse

The obverse design of the 2015 Proof New Mexico Navajo Cougar 1 oz Silver Coin features the image of a member of the Navajo tribe. The lone Navajo tribal member is depicted wearing a traditional headdress and also a cloth wrap across his face to keep the dusty winds at bay. Also featured on the obverse side of the coin is the name of the Navajo tribe, the metal content, year of release, face value and weight of the coin.

Reverse

The reverse design of the 2015 Proof New Mexico Navajo Cougar 1 oz Silver Coin features the image of the North American cougar settled on a rock. This large wild cat is also often referred to as a mountain lion and can live as long as 13 years in the wild. While cougars are efficient and deadly hunters, fatal attacks are exceptionally rare as the cougar tends to be a shy and solitary creature. Also featured on the reverse side of the coin are New Mexico Cougar and America. Jamul Sovereign Nation is also engraved on the reverse of the coin.

Your 2015 Proof New Mexico Navajo Cougar 1 oz Silver Coin will have a beautiful satin finish. The glossy mirror-like finish adds to the beauty of this well-designed coin.

The coin has an assigned face value but it is not considered to be legal tender in the United States. This is because only the United States Mint is permitted to produce legal tender.
